Output f0ffec825c3e258775d1f93dde9ed2bf8e5c60e3745917f90f86c6d8d8868783:1

value
10699572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ff290f09e3dcf25b7367a25d088040411532c610 OP_EQUAL
address
3QxBRGjcDZA6wQyGbuSUKXEZAZVMRfBU6A
transaction
f0ffec825c3e258775d1f93dde9ed2bf8e5c60e3745917f90f86c6d8d8868783
spent
true